Crockett Int is a State/Public serving middle age pupils, located in Paris, Lamar County. The school has 560 pupils enrolled. The Principal is Kimberly Donnan. It is part of the Paris Isd school district. It serves grades 5โ6 in a small-town setting. The school employs 37.7 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 14.8:1. 33% of students are proficient in reading. 33% are proficient in maths. Crockett Int enrolls 560 students across grades 5โ6. The student body is 53% male and 48% female. A teaching staff of 37.7 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 14.8: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 34% White, 31% Black or African American and 25% Hispanic or Latino.

441 of the school's 560 students (79%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 428 qualify for free lunch and 13 for a reduced price.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Crockett Int is located in a small-town setting (NCES locale: Town, Remote). The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. Crockett Int is one of 8 schools in PARIS ISD, based in PARIS, Texas. The district serves 3,832 students district-wide and employs 305 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 560 students, Crockett Int is larger than the district average of about 479 students per school.
